INVENTORS: RUDOLF ROSSMANN and PAUL CAHANNES INVENTION: SAFETY APPARATUS FOR SPINNING PROJECTILE FUZES ABSTRACT OF THE DISCLOSURE A spinning projectile fuze contains a rotor which is retained by a safety spring in the form of a substantially ring-shaped disk in a safety or unarmed position. To enable the ring-shaped disk to release the rotor it must be pressed flat both by the firing acceleration and also by the spin. This ring-shaped disk possesses cut-outs or recesses by means of which it is subdivided into segments which are bent in an undulated or wave-shaped configuration.
